問題タブ [adaptive-design]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
angularjs - AngularJS のアダプティブ レイアウト (モバイル/デスクトップ) - 推奨される方法は何ですか (内部の例)
AngularJS でアダプティブ (レスポンシブではありません) レイアウトを処理するための推奨される方法は何ですか? 私がする必要があるのは、デスクトップとモバイル用に異なる共有コンポーネント (共有ディレクティブとコントローラー) を持つ別のレイアウトを持つことです。私は ui-router の使用を考えていましたが、これが私が今持っているものです:
index.html (メイン ファイル):
desktop.html (デスクトップ コンテンツのラッパー):
mobile.html (モバイル コンテンツのラッパー):
user.html (共有コンテンツ):
app.js
プレビューと編集:
http://plnkr.co/edit/gRnTJkMa7hTLnffOERMT?p=preview
- これは、アダプティブ レイアウトを行うための推奨される方法ですか?
どうすれば(このアプローチで):
- モバイル/デスクトップの選択に基づいて index.html にクラスを追加します
- mobile.css または desktop.css を動的に読み込む
よろしくお願いします、
jquery - ウィンドウのサイズ変更時に JQuery が自動中央揃え
グーグルで調べて、divを水平および垂直に自動センタリングするためのjQueryスクリプトを見つけました。
例とまったく同じように追加されましたが、1 つの理由により、div はページの読み込みによって中央に配置されず、ウィンドウのサイズ変更時にのみ追加されました。
リンク コードの例: http://demo.tutorialzine.com/2010/03/centering-div-vertically-and-horizontally /demo.html
デモの例: http://demo.tutorialzine.com/2010/03/centering-div-vertically-and-horizontally /3.html
私が作成したリンクはオンラインです (テスト): http://i333180.iris.fhict.nl/test/index.html
そして、source-center.js でわかるように、サンプル コードとまったく同じですが、ウィンドウのサイズが変更されたときにのみ中央に配置されます。ありがとう
c# - ASP.NET Mobile ビュー: Firefox Mobile をモバイルとして検出しない
私は ASP.NET MVC 5 を使用しています.mobile
。いくつかの特定のシナリオでは、一連のビューをレンダリングします。
.mobile
Android 上の Mozilla Firefox モバイル アプリが、レンダリングされたビューのバージョンを取得していないことに気付きました。これは、デバイスがモバイルであることを ASP.NET が検出していないようです。
ユーザー エージェント文字列は次のとおりです。
Mozilla/5.0 (Android; モバイル; rv:39.0) Gecko/39.0 Firefox/39.0
これを強制するためにモバイル検出をグローバルにオーバーライドする方法はありますか?
java - Android: GridView の 1 行にある ImageView の高さを等しくする
向きと画面サイズに応じて、1〜3列のGridLayoutがあります。各 GridLayout アイテムは、ImageView などを含む垂直方向の LinearLayout (TextViews を含む LinearLayout など) です。画像にはさまざまなサイズがあります。画像をトリミングするための簡単なアルゴリズムを作成しました。正常に動作する場合もありますが (ゆっくりスクロールする場合など)、結果がまったく表示されない場合もあります。高速スクロール中に項目が消えることがあります。SquareImageView は知っていますが、私の画像は正方形ではなく横長です。すべてのアイテムの画像の高さを 1 行に設定したい。
私の GridView は次のようになります。
setAdapter の後:
MainHelper.adjustImgHeights:
コードの何が問題になっていますか?
c# - WPF コード ビハインドから XAML で定義されている現在の VisualState を決定する
私は現在、WPFアプリケーションに取り組んでいます。Visual State Manager を にAdaptiveTrigger
基づくとともに使用MinWindowWidth
して、マークアップによってすべて定義および制御されるアダプティブ レイアウトを作成していますXAML
。ViewModel から状態を作成または変更することはまったくありません。
いくつかの状態が定義されていますが、コード ビハインドからユーザーのウィンドウが現在どの状態にあるかを判断する方法があるC#
かどうか疑問に思っています。
コード ビハインドからビジュアル ステートを作成および変更する方法を見てきましたが、Visual State Manager が完全にViewModel ではなく View です。
css - IE モバイル ビューでの CSS ボーダーの重複
これを読んでくれてありがとう - 誰かがここで私を助けてくれることを本当に願っています. 私はアダプティブ サイト (レスポンシブではない) を持っており、このページでは:
http://www.findspace.co.uk/pages/3bed-student-accommodation-newcastle.html
div 'containerDDbeds' に適用されたボーダートップ スタイルに問題があります。境界線スタイルを使用して、プロパティ情報の各セット間に水平方向の罫線を追加しています。最初の 3 つは説明用です。iPhone では問題ないように見えますが、IE の Nokia Lumia 630 Windows phone では、この Browserstack エミュレーションに示されているように、ルールが重複しています (実際には境界線のある div 全体である可能性があります)。私は本当に各プロパティの写真の上にそれらを必要とするだけです. IE モバイル ビューのハックが必要なのだろうか? サイトのデスクトップ バージョンは問題ありません。これは単なるモバイル ビューです。どんな助けや指針も大いに受け取られるでしょう。アントニー
これは、モバイルCSSファイルのモバイルCSSへのリンクです
javascript - Javascript / ページ上の画像要素を取得しますが、それは div (getElementByID) にあります
バナーの場合、同じページに表示される画像を配置する必要があります。私は開発者として本当に下手です - だから、私はこの方法を使います - しかし、実際、それはうまくいきません...
最も重要な部分 -
みんなありがとう !ルドヴィク
html - フレックスボックスの複数行。使い方: flex-wrap: ラップ?
私はこのようにしなければなりません。ワイド、ミドル、スモールスクリーン用 https://pp.vk.me/c629328/v629328337/21bd7/izp9QG8Qcg4.jpg
これが私のコードです